Understanding UPVC Windows and Doors: A Comprehensive Guide
U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) doors and windows have amassed considerable attention over the previous couple of decades, becoming a popular choice amongst property owners and home builders alike. Understood for their resilience, energy efficiency, and low upkeep requirements, UPVC items provide a number of advantages over standard materials like wood or metal. This short article will explore the benefits, features, installation procedures, and maintenance pointers related to UPVC doors and windows.

What is UPVC?
UPVC means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ride, a type of rigid plastic that is commonly used in building and construction. Unlike PVC, UPVC does not contain plasticizers, making it more robust and durable. This material has actually become a staple in the window and door market due to its residential or commercial properties such as weather condition resistance, thermal insulation, and soundproofing capabilities.
Key Features of UPVC Windows and Doors
Before considering UPVC windows and doors & Windows, it's important to understand their crucial functions:
1. Durability and Longevity
UPVC products are resistant to rot, rust, and fading. Unlike wood, they do not warp or fracture due to weather modifications, guaranteeing years of trouble-free usage.
2. Energy Efficiency
UPVC windows and doors boast exceptional insulation homes, lowering energy costs by reducing heat transfer. This can cause a more comfortable indoor environment and substantial cost savings on heating & cooling costs.
3. Low Maintenance Requirements
Among the piece de resistances of UPVC is its low maintenance nature. Cleaning up includes just soap and water, without any requirement for painting or sealing.
4. Security Features
Modern UPVC doors and windows come geared up with sophisticated locking systems and multi-point locks, enhancing the security of homes.
5. Visual Flexibility
UPVC doors and windows are available in different styles, colors, and surfaces, allowing house owners to choose designs that complement their architecture.
6. Ecologically Friendly
UPVC can be recycled without losing its structural residential or commercial properties, contributing favorably to ecological sustainability.

Installation Process for UPVC Windows and Doors
The setup of UPVC windows and doors is a vital procedure that needs accuracy and competence. Here is a step-by-step guide:
- Measurement: Accurate measurements are vital for choosing the right-sized UPVC window or door.
- Removal of Old Windows/Doors: If changing, the old windows or doors need to be thoroughly gotten rid of to prevent damaging the surrounding walls.
- Preparation of the Opening: Ensure that the opening is clean, dry, and structurally noise. Look for leaks or drafts that might result in issues.
- Setup of Window/Door Frame: The UPVC frame is fitted into the opening, ensuring it is leveled and plumb.
- Sealing: A suitable sealant, typically silicone-based, is used around the area in between the frame and the wall to avoid air and water seepage.
- Fitting Windows/Doors: The glazing units are added to the frames, and doors are hung utilizing suitable hinges.
- Final Checks: Operate all doors and windows to guarantee they open, close, and lock smoothly. Inspect for any gaps or leaks.
Maintenance Tips for UPVC Products
Maintaining UPVC windows and doors is straightforward and needs minimal effort. Here are some crucial upkeep tips:
- Clean Regularly: Use warm, soapy water to clean up the frames and glass a minimum of twice a year.
- Examine Seals and Gaskets: Regularly inspect the seals and gaskets for any indications of wear and tear. Change if needed.
- Oil Locks and Hinges: Apply a silicone spray lubricant to locks and hinges to preserve smooth functionality.
- Clear Drainage Slots: Ensure that drain slots (if present) are devoid of debris for reliable water expulsion.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: Are UPVC windows energy-efficient?
Yes, UPVC windows have exceptional insulation homes, considerably minimizing heat loss during winter and keeping homes cool in summer season, contributing to lower energy bills.
Q2: Do UPVC windows come with a warranty?
A lot of UPVC window manufacturers provide service warranties that generally range from 5 to 20 years, covering production flaws and efficiency.
Q3: Can UPVC windows be painted?
It's usually not a good idea to paint UPVC windows as it can void service warranties. Rather, consider picking a color that matches your home when acquiring.
Q4: Are UPVC doors protect?
UPVC doors feature multi-point locking systems that offer boosted security. They are frequently tested to meet strict security requirements.
Q5: How long do UPVC doors and windows last?
With appropriate upkeep, UPVC doors and windows can last for 20 to 30 years or even longer.
